To understand the finale, one must understand the premise. The title, Prison on the Saddle , refers to a specific geographical and metaphorical space. A "saddle" in geography is the low point between two higher peaks. It is a place of passage, yet in Shimizuan’s narrative, it becomes a place of stagnation—a prison.
